Informes de facturación de EE. UU.

Esta página describe los archivos de datos que RCS for Business crea para ayudar a las operadoras estadounidenses con la facturación y la auditoría conforme al marco RBM de EE. UU. Para obtener más información sobre el marco RBM de EE. UU., también puede consultar usrbm.org .

El informe de facturación es un informe consolidado de los eventos facturables entre los agentes y usuarios. Facturable significa simplemente que un evento es susceptible de generar un cargo. Los operadores determinan si se facturan los eventos y cómo se facturan. Todos los operadores estadounidenses que utilizan activamente RCS for Business tienen acceso a los informes de facturación.

Para obtener más información sobre el modelo de clasificación de facturación de EE. UU., consulte las preguntas frecuentes sobre facturación en EE. UU .

Generación de archivos

Para obtener más información, consulte Generación de archivos .

Almacenamiento y acceso a archivos

Para obtener más información, consulte Almacenamiento y acceso a archivos .

Disponibilidad de archivos

Para obtener más información, consulte la disponibilidad de archivos .

Informes de facturación

Los informes de facturación son registros de eventos facturables , que se calculan en función de la categoría de facturación del agente y el tipo de mensajes que envía. Estos informes están disponibles para todos los operadores que utilizan activamente RCS for Business.

Los informes de facturación contienen información confidencial, pero no información personal identificable (PII) del usuario, como MSISDN, MSISDN cifrado o cualquier identificador único del usuario.

Categorías de facturación frente a eventos facturables

La distinción entre las categorías de facturación de los agentes y los eventos facturables es clave para comprender cómo se factura a su agente.

  • La categoría de facturación es una clasificación fija que usted elige al crear su agente. Determina el método de facturación de su agente: por mensaje (agentes no conversacionales) o por sesión (agentes conversacionales).
  • Los eventos facturables son interacciones entre un agente de RCS for Business y un usuario que se registran con fines de facturación (por ejemplo, rich_message ).

Categorías de facturación de agentes estadounidenses

Al crear un agente, el propietario define su categoría de facturación según cómo interactuará con los usuarios. Esta categoría no limita la cantidad ni el tipo de mensajes que puede enviar, pero sí determina cómo se le facturarán. Las dos categorías principales de facturación se describen en la siguiente tabla.

Categoría de facturación Tipo de agente Ejemplos de casos de uso Método de facturación
No conversacional Agentes que principalmente envían mensajes unidireccionales.
  • OTP
  • Alertas
  • Ofertas promocionales
Se factura por cada mensaje entregado al usuario.
Conversacional Agentes diseñados para facilitar el intercambio bidireccional con los usuarios, independientemente de quién inicie la conversación.
  • Encontrar el producto adecuado
  • Reservar un billete
  • Solución de problemas
Facturación por sesión : Si se cumplen los criterios de la sesión, todos los mensajes rich media y rich media dentro del período de 24 horas de la sesión se facturarán a una tarifa plana, independientemente de su duración o segmentos.

Facturación por mensaje : Si no se cumplen los criterios de la sesión o un mensaje queda fuera del plazo de 24 horas, se facturará individualmente a una tarifa por mensaje para contenido multimedia enriquecido, según la lista de precios del operador correspondiente.

Agentes conversacionales versus agentes no conversacionales

Existen dos categorías de facturación para agentes: conversacionales y no conversacionales.

  • Los agentes no conversacionales cobran por cada mensaje que entregan al usuario.

    • Esta categoría es la más adecuada para agentes que no esperan respuestas frecuentes.
  • Los agentes conversacionales se facturan a una tarifa plana por sesión, siempre que se inicie una sesión. Esta tarifa incluye todos los mensajes intercambiados en un período de 24 horas, incluidos los que iniciaron la sesión. Los agentes conversacionales pueden generar cargos por mensajes que no formen parte de una sesión de 24 horas.

    • Esta categoría es la más adecuada para agentes que participan en conversaciones de varios turnos con los usuarios.

Lógica de facturación de sesiones

Según el modelo de facturación estadounidense, una sesión se activa mediante una secuencia de 4 mensajes rich media (incluidos al menos 2 mensajes MO y al menos 1 mensaje MT) intercambiados en un plazo de 24 horas a partir del primer mensaje de la secuencia. Una vez alcanzado este umbral, todos los mensajes dentro de ese plazo de 24 horas se facturan como una sola sesión . Los mensajes que queden fuera de este plazo o que no activen una sesión se facturarán a la tarifa estándar por mensaje para rich media, según la lista de precios del operador.

El siguiente diagrama muestra un ejemplo de una sesión de facturación A2P para agentes conversacionales.

  • MT (Mobile Terminated) es un mensaje enviado por la empresa.
  • MO (Mobile Originated) es un mensaje o acción iniciada por el usuario.

US billing - Session

Eventos facturables

Los flujos de mensajería se clasifican según su origen y dirección. Para describir la dirección del tráfico de mensajería, los operadores estadounidenses suelen utilizar la terminología MT/MO . Estos términos se corresponden con la terminología A2P/P2A utilizada en toda la documentación de RCS for Business. A continuación, se presenta un breve resumen de la relación entre estos términos:

  • A2P (Application-to-Person) es MT (Mobile Terminated) : un mensaje enviado por la empresa.
  • P2A (de persona a aplicación) es MO (originado desde el móvil) : un mensaje o acción iniciada por el usuario.
Evento Descripción Agentes no conversacionales Agentes conversacionales
a2p_rich_message Mensaje enviado por un agente que contiene únicamente texto, respuestas sugeridas o acciones específicas sugeridas (Marcar un número, Abrir una URL en el navegador). Siempre se trata como un evento facturable individual.

Se factura por mensaje en función de los segmentos (1 segmento equivale a 160 bytes UTF-8).

Se considera un evento facturable individual a menos que pase a formar parte de una sesión.
p2a_rich_message Un mensaje enviado por el usuario que contiene únicamente texto libre o texto resultante de seleccionar una respuesta sugerida. Siempre se trata como un evento facturable individual.

Se factura por mensaje según los segmentos.

Se considera un evento facturable individual a menos que pase a formar parte de una sesión.
a2p_rich_media_message Mensaje enviado por un agente que contiene contenido multimedia (imagen, vídeo, audio), tarjetas enriquecidas, carruseles o acciones complejas como "Ver ubicación". Siempre se trata como un evento facturable individual.

Se factura como un único evento a precio fijo, independientemente de su tamaño o contenido.

Se considera un evento facturable individual a menos que pase a formar parte de una sesión.
p2a_rich_media_message Mensaje enviado por el usuario que contiene un archivo multimedia subido (imagen, vídeo, audio). Siempre se trata como un evento facturable individual.

Se factura como un único evento con tarifa plana.

Se considera un evento facturable individual a menos que pase a formar parte de una sesión.
p2a_suggested_action El usuario pulsa sobre cualquier acción sugerida (por ejemplo, "Ver ubicación") que no sea una respuesta sugerida. Siempre se trata como un evento facturable individual.

Genera un evento facturable por cada clic.

Se trata como un evento facturable individual y genera un evento facturable por clic, a menos que pase a formar parte de una sesión.
a2p_session Una ventana de interacción de 24 horas que comienza cuando se inicia un disparador de sesión y el primer mensaje es MT. Para obtener más información, consulte ¿Qué es una sesión y cómo funciona ? No aplica. Las sesiones no se aplican a los agentes no conversacionales. Una vez activada, todos los mensajes dentro del período de 24 horas están cubiertos por una única tarifa de sesión. Cualquier evento facturable dentro de la sesión de 24 horas se asignará al ID de evento facturable de la sesión.
p2a_session Una ventana de interacción de 24 horas que comienza cuando se inicia un disparador de sesión y el primer mensaje es MO. Para obtener más información, consulte ¿Qué es una sesión y cómo funciona ? No aplica. Las sesiones no se aplican a los agentes no conversacionales. Una vez activada, todos los mensajes dentro del período de 24 horas están cubiertos por una única tarifa de sesión. Cualquier evento facturable dentro de la sesión de 24 horas se asignará al ID de evento facturable de la sesión.

Generación de informes de facturación

Solo los agentes con tráfico que no sea de prueba generan eventos facturables. La actividad de los números de teléfono de prueba no aparece en los informes de facturación.

Estos informes parten de la base de que los eventos se facturan cuando se entregan los mensajes A2P, no cuando se envían. Un mensaje no entregado o cancelado antes de su entrega no genera un evento facturable.

Formato del informe de facturación

Los informes de facturación utilizan el formato de nombre de archivo rbm_billable_events_YYYY-MM-DD.csv . La fecha que aparece en el nombre del archivo es la fecha de generación del archivo.

Cada línea del informe representa un evento facturable. Las sesiones A2P/P2A se representan mediante varias filas, una por cada mensaje intercambiado. Cada fila asociada a una sesión (que comparte el mismo billing_event_id ) mostrará el número total de mensajes MT y MO durante las 24 horas de la sesión en las columnas mt_messages y mo_messages .

Cada registro del informe contiene la siguiente información para cada evento facturable.

Campo Formato Descripción Ejemplo
billing_event_id cadena Identificador generado que distingue el evento facturable.

Todos los mensajes que formen parte de una sesión tendrán el mismo billing_event_id .

63ed6dc0454958763224ca43cf09388afe9bce5ad2f2b1d66236190074hd5g5e
type cadena Tipo de evento:
  • a2p_rich_message
  • a2p_rich_media_message
  • p2a_rich_message
  • p2a_rich_media_message
  • p2a_suggested_action
  • p2a_rich_message
    agent_id cadena Identificador único del agente que participó en el evento. acme_342h23_agent@rbm.goog
    agent_owner cadena Dirección de correo electrónico del propietario actual de la cuenta de socio donde se creó el agente. marketing@xyzaggregator.com
    billing_party cadena Partido que factura los eventos. transportador
    max_duration_single_message número Tiempo máximo (en horas) permitido para que un usuario responda a un mensaje del agente antes de que se cierre la ventana de inicio de conversación y el mensaje se clasifique como un evento de single_message . No aplicable al modelo estadounidense para mensajes enriquecidos individuales. 24
    max_duration_a2p_conversation número Para el programa piloto de sesiones, esto refleja la ventana de sesión de 24 horas medida desde el primer mensaje en la secuencia de activación. La duración se mide en horas. 24
    max_duration_p2a_conversation número Para el programa piloto de sesiones, esto refleja la ventana de sesión de 24 horas medida a partir del primer mensaje en la secuencia de activación. 24
    start_time AAAA-mm-ddTHH:00:00Z

    Fecha y hora UTC en que comenzó el evento (ISO 8601). Para las sesiones, esta es la marca de tiempo del primer mensaje en la secuencia de activación.

    A2P

  • Para eventos que no son de sesión, como a2p_rich_message y a2p_rich_media_message , este es el momento en que se entrega el mensaje al usuario.
  • En el caso del evento a2p_session , este es el momento en que se entrega al usuario el primer mensaje de la conversación.
  • P2A

  • Para eventos que no son de sesión, como p2a_rich_message y p2a_rich_media_message , este es el momento en que el usuario envía el mensaje.
  • En el caso del evento p2a_session , este es el momento en que el usuario envía el primer mensaje de la conversación.
  • 2025-05-20T08:00:00Z
    duration número La duración se refiere únicamente a las sesiones y se mide en minutos. Cuando el evento no pertenece a una sesión, el valor es 0. 45
    mt_messages número Número de mensajes terminados en dispositivos móviles (A2P) en el evento. Para las sesiones, cada fila que comparte el mismo billing_event_id muestra el número total de mensajes MT en toda la sesión. 5
    mo_messages número Número de mensajes originados desde dispositivos móviles (P2A) en el evento. Para las sesiones, cada fila que comparte el mismo billing_event_id muestra el número total de mensajes MO en toda la sesión. 3
    size_kilobytes número Tamaño de todos los archivos adjuntos a los mensajes del evento, redondeado al kilobyte más cercano (1 kB equivale a 1024 bytes). 912
    agent_name cadena Nombre del agente que participó en el evento. ACME Brand
    owner_name cadena Nombre del propietario actual de la cuenta de socio donde se creó el agente. XYZ Aggregator
    segment_count número El recuento de segmentos calculado para a2p_rich_message events y p2a_rich_message (1 segmento equivale a 160 bytes UTF-8). Cuando el evento no es ninguno de los mencionados, el valor es 0. 5
    session_type cadena Tipo de sesión:
  • a2p_session
  • p2a_session
  • Estará vacío si la actividad no califica como sesión.
    a2p_session

    Informe de facturación de muestra

    Puede descargar un informe de muestra:

    Tamaño típico del archivo

    El tamaño de un informe diario de un socio activo de RCS for Business depende de la cantidad de actividad que haya generado en la red del operador.